The Brain That Changes Itself: Stories of Personal Triumph from the Frontiers of Brain Science

by Norman Doidge

In this transformative exploration of neuroplasticity, Dr. Norman Doidge reveals the incredible ability of the human brain to change and adapt throughout life. Challenging the long-standing belief that the brain's structure is fixed, Doidge shares inspiring stories of individuals who have overcome significant challenges through the power of brain change.

The book features remarkable accounts, such as a woman born with half a brain who rewired herself to function normally, blind individuals who learned to see, and children with cerebral palsy discovering new ways to move.
